Section 143.051 - Cause for Removal or Suspension

A commission rule prescribing cause for removal or suspension of a fire fighter or police officer is not valid unless it involves one or more of the following grounds:

(1) conviction of a felony or other crime involving moral turpitude;
(2) violations of a municipal charter provision;
(3) acts of incompetency;
(4) neglect of duty;
(5) discourtesy to the public or to a fellow employee while the fire fighter or police officer is in the line of duty;
(6) acts showing lack of good moral character;
(7) drinking intoxicants while on duty or intoxication while off duty;
(8) conduct prejudicial to good order;
(9) refusal or neglect to pay just debts;
(10) absence without leave;
(11) shirking duty or cowardice at fires, if applicable; or
(12) violation of an applicable fire or police department rule or special order.
